Highlights

> One of the largest primary rutile mines, which has achieved transformational operating improvements

– World’s largest primary rutile asset with a JORC-compliant resource in excess of 840 million tonnes at 1.0% rutile

– Capital investment initiated in 2010 continues to yield significant operating improvements

– H2 2012 rutile production run-rate of over 103,000 tonnes per year, up from 54,000 tonnes in H1 2011

– 2013 target production of 125,000 tonnes of rutile

> Lanti Dry Mining project has been commissioned, providing a step-change in production

– Delivered on budget and ahead of schedule, the operation is currently operating above name-plate capacity

– Forecast production of 30,000-35,000 tonnes per annum at a highly-competitive operating cost

> Gangama Dry Mining project will deliver continued production growth and unprecedented financial returns

– Gangama Dry Mining project, which will treat 1,000tph of ore, is a scaled-up (2x) version of the Lanti Dry Mining project

– Scheduled to start production in 2014

– Targets high-grade resources, resulting in production of over 83,000 tonnes of rutile per annum

– Pre-tax IRR of 228% and NPV10 of US$507 million

> Substantial cash flow being generated

– Significant revenue growth resulting from a substantial production increase

– Declining per tonne operating costs resulting from realized economies of scale and a continual focus on cost efficiency

> Strong project pipeline provides additional long-term value

– Both the Sembehun Dredge project and Mogbwemo Tailings project provide low-cost, long-life development opportunities

> The largest primary rutile asset in the world

– JORC Mineral Resource in excess of 840 million tonnes at 1.0% rutile

– Lanti: 63 Mt at 1.42% rutile

– Gangama: 48 Mt at 1.44% rutile

– Gbeni: 63 Mt at 1.20% rutile

– Sembehun: 274 Mt at 1.34% rutile

> Exceptional, high value assemblage

– 76% of payable heavy mineral1 is rutile

– 22% of payable heavy mineral1 is zircon

Established Infrastructure and Skilled Workforce

Working for a better Sierra Leone

> Significant infrastructure already in place

– Mineral separation plant, currently capable of operating at a rate of 165,000 tonnes of rutile per annum is easily expandable to >200,000 tonnes of rutile per annum

– Established export port and shipping fleet with capacity to ship >500,000 tonnes of product per annum

– A modern MFO (Marine Fuel Oil) power plant capable of producing 23MW of power (current utilisation under 9MW)

– Over 80km of established haulage roads

– Modern engineering and camp facilities in place

> Skilled and experienced workforce

– Experienced management team

– +40 years of experience operating in Sierra Leone and with these deposits

– >95% of workforce are Sierra Leonean nationals

– Highly educated employees

– Significant recruitment from premier universities of Sierra Leone, Fourah and Njala

Significant Improvement in Existing Operations

Working for a better Sierra Leone

> Lanti Dredge and process plants upgraded

– Following a capital investment programme initiated in October 2010, operational improvements have driven significant production increases

– 2012 production of 94,493 tonnes of rutile, a 39% increase on 2011 production

– Record six-month production of 51,833 tonnes of rutile in H2 2012 – 91% growth in run-rate production relative to H1 2011

– 2013 production target of 125,000 tonnes of rutile

– Substantial improvements in process recoveries have contributed to increased production and enhanced operating margins

Lanti Dry Mining: A Step Change in Production

Working for a better Sierra Leone

The Lanti Dry Mining project has been delivered on budget and ahead of time

> The Operation

– Targets high-grade resources, inaccessible to dredge mining, totalling 28.1 million tonnes at 1.5% rutile

– Adds production of 30,000 to 35,000 tonnes per annum of rutile as well as ilmenite and zircon by-products

> Implementation

– Ore processing plant has been commissioned, on budget and ahead of time

– The mining operation and concentrator plant are operating above design capacity

Gangama Dry Mining PFS: Key Project Highlights

Average annual production rate (ore mined) 7.0 million tpa

Average annual production rate (rutile produced) 83,400 tpa

Project life 6 years

Up-front capital expenditure $103 million

Operating cost (LOM) $307/t

Construction period 12 months

Pre-tax NPV10 $507 million

Pre-tax IRR 228%

Gangama Dry Mining: Adds Unparalleled Value

Working for a better Sierra Leone

Gangama Dry Mine provides unparalleled value by accessing a high-grade resource while minimising development time and capital cost

> The Project

– The Gangama Dry Mining project is operationally identical to the Lanti Dry Mining project

– Annual production of 83,400 tonnes of rutile

– The 1,000 tph project consisting of 2x500 tonne per hour units

– Power, water and road access is already in place

– Internal pre-feasibility study has been completed, incorporating known costs, timelines and project learnings from the Lanti Dry Mining project

Sembehun Dredge: Long-Term Upside Value

Working for a better Sierra Leone

> The Project

– An independent scoping study, completed by Snowden Mining Industry Consultants, identified significant value in an independent dredge mining operation at Sembehun

– 274 million tonnes at 1.34% rutile in Sembehun provides the opportunity to develop a new project that delivers long-term returns

– Baseline pre-tax NPV of US$347 million with opportunity for further value enhancements

> Project Update

– An exploration programme was commenced in October 2012 to support detailed mine planning

Deposit Mining Pond Mining Lease Boundary Proposed Dam Final Product Haul Road Existing Road HMC Hauling Road

Source: Snowden Mining Industry Consultants study

Sembehun Dredge study: Key Project Highlights

Baseline Pre-tax NPV10 $347 million

Baseline Pre-tax IRR 34%

Average production rate (ore

mined) 13 million tpa

Average rutile production rate

first 5 years / LOM 135,000 tpa / 113,000 tpa

Up-front capital expenditure $305 million

Operating cost $322/t HM produced

Construction period 24 months

Project life 22 years

Over 40 years, Sierra Rutile has forged strong relationships with the people and Government of Sierra Leone

> Investment friendly jurisdiction

– Sierra Leone is a stable and investor-friendly country

– Sierra Leone has a pro-mining investment climate attracting African Minerals’ US$1.8 billion iron ore project and London Mining’s US$1.0 billion iron ore project

– Sierra Leone is a key part of Tony Blair’s African Governance Initiative which is working to develop the capacity of the Government to set and deliver on its priorities

> Strong relationship with Sierra Leone

– The Company has a positive and long-standing relationship with the Government

– Mining leases date back to the 1970s and are valid through 2038 with the option to extend for a further 15 years

– In March 2011, a special prepayment of US$18.3m was made on a loan to Government of Sierra Leone. The monies repaid on this loan are used to fund local development projects such as roads and infrastructure. US$30.9m (€23.8m) is outstanding on the loan, which will be repaid in accordance with its terms over the next 4 years

– In April 2012, Sierra Rutile purchased the Governments 7.1% effective interest in the local subsidiary and pre-paid two years of PAYE tax for US$17m

Sierra Rutile and the Community

Working for a better Sierra Leone

Aquaculture Sustenance Programme

Sierra Rutile is a powerful force for development in the local community

Local library

Source: Sierra Rutile

> Considerable contribution to national and local economy

– Sierra Rutile makes up a significant proportion of Sierra Leonean GDP and exports

– The Company is one of the largest private sector employers in Sierra Leone

– Where possible, the Company is committed to local procurement, spending over US$45m annually on in-country procurement and wages

– Long standing and positive relations with local Mine Workers Union

> Contributions to the local community

– Over US$1.5m invested annually in the local community

– The Company’s medical facility treats over 22,000 people a year with free HIV testing, education and mosquito nets for malaria prevention

– Local technical college, sponsored by Sierra Rutile, provides education to over 300 students

– Through the Sierra Rutile Foundation, the Company funds local projects such as schools, wells, grain stores, latrines, courts, bridges, clinics, a local radio station and more

– Fish farms located in old mining ponds provide local villagers with work and a reliable source of food

A Responsible Steward

Working for a better Sierra Leone

>Ongoing Land Rehabilitation Programme

Tree planting

> Environmental management

– A survey of all legacy disturbed lands was completed in 2011, resulting in the development of a six year rehabilitation plan

– Rehabilitation plan is underway with 141.1 hectares of land restored during 2012 – 20 hectares above target

– Through the aquaculture project, Sierra Rutile successfully stocked retired dredge ponds with a total of 147,247 tilapia and cat fish during 2012

– Over 180,000 fish to be stocked during 2013

– Sierra Rutile continues to maintain strong, positive relationships with the Sierra Leone Environmental Protection Agency and Ministries of Fisheries and Agriculture
